Address

NXYD5FMfpETYGKApgVT8XFRFgU89zBNQYP

0 XNA

Confirmed
Total Received877.02511850 XNA
Total Sent877.02511850 XNA
Final Balance0 XNA
No. Transactions2

Transactions

 
 
NXYD5FMfpETYGKApgVT8XFRFgU89zBNQYP877.02511850 XNA